2. Energy efficient

wall hung electric fires mounted electric fireplaces produce heat using a heating element in contrast to wood burning fireplaces that require chimneys and costly installation. These are great options for installing a fireplace in areas where a fire would not be suitable. They are available in different sizes and shapes, and can be designed to look like the traditional log fireplace.

Typically, they are constructed with a fan heater that blows hot air into the room to warm it up. They are rated according to the space they can heat. They are available in various BTU capacities. They are more efficient than other fireplaces.

They are an alternative to traditional fireplaces as they don't require open flames or burning fuel. They also have a minimal contact with your flooring and don't emit any smoke. A lot of models come with timers that turn them off after 30 minutes to 9 hours. This helps in preventing any overheating of the space and ensures that your family members can get a good night's rest.

4. Installation Ease

Wall-mounted fireplaces are a great option to change the look of any room and add a modern, sophisticated look. Installation is simple and they provide efficient heating in any space. With a variety of styles and designs available there is bound to be a design that meets your needs and budget.

In contrast to wood-burning fireplaces and traditional brick chimneys that could cost several thousand dollars or more, a simple gas or electric wall mount fire will run you about 1,000 or less. This makes it a cost-effective option for those looking to add warmth and class without spending a fortune in renovations.

The installation procedure of a wall mounted fire is very easy and can be completed by a certified professional electrician within a couple of hours. You will need to connect a 120v or 240v electrical outlet or wall socket in the area where you wish to hang the fire. A professional can do this job safely and avoid damaging any pipes or wires.

The brackets for mounting along with all the necessary hardware to hang your fireplace will usually be included in the packaging. The brackets should be hung on anchors or studs made of plastic. Be sure that they are strong enough for the weight of the fireplace (typically between 50-200 pounds). Once the wall-mounting brackets have been securely attached, hang your fireplace on the brackets using either screws or hooks. It is recommended to anchor the fireplace brackets by putting a screw in each corner, making sure that they are perfectly level.

Then, plug the fireplace into the power socket and ensure that you are happy with how it is set up. If not, you can always move it to a different spot until you are happy with the results. Remember that you should not block your fireplace with extra tile or trim as this will block the air flow and cause it to overheat.
